
Tart cranberry, zesty lime, and a homemade ginger syrup come together in a sparkling drink that feels genuinely festive without a drop of alcohol. The ginger syrup is the real star here β just fresh ginger, maple syrup, and water simmered together until fragrant, then strained into a silky concentrate that adds warmth and depth to every sip. Because everything is made from scratch with whole, recognizable ingredients, there are no hidden additives or stabilizers to worry about β just pure, clean flavor. Store-bought flavored drinks and mixers are notorious for sneaking in unnecessary additives, so shaking this up at home is a satisfying way to stay in control of what's in your glass. The method is simple: shake the cranberry, lime, and ginger syrup over ice, then top with chilled sparkling water for a beautiful fizz that stays lively right to the last sip. A lime wedge and fresh mint make it look like something you'd order at a fancy bar, but it comes together in under 20 minutes with minimal effort. Combine the sliced ginger, maple syrup, and water in a small saucepan over medium heat, stirring until the maple syrup dissolves. Bring to a gentle simmer and cook for 3 minutes, until the syrup is fragrant and the ginger has softened slightly.
Remove from the heat and let the syrup steep for 10 minutes, then strain through a fine-mesh strainer into a small bowl or jar, pressing the ginger slices to extract as much liquid as possible. Discard the solids.
